Garden of the Phoenix is a 2 bed/1 bath, upstairs unit with a lanai facing State Land, 100s of acres of native Ohia Forest, the first tree to sprout and grow on fresh lava. It is about 1.5 miles distance to the clothing optional black sand beach known as Kehena where wild dolphins sometimes swim with beach goers and Sundays are drum circles. The neighborhood has a Dark Sky policy to promote star gazing. Uncle Robert’s offers a variety of Farmer’s Markets and evening music with a bar and smoothie shack.
